For best search engine optimization, every webmaster must use keywords and keywords phrases effectively. This means he must use keywords that are relevant to the content of a webpage. However, besides keyword relevancy, search engines also take keyword density into account.
There is no exact rule about how many times a keyword or keyword phrase can be placed in a webpage. However it is wise to use your most important keywords and/or keyword phrases throughout your copy but without sounding repetitious.

Actually you can count the density percentage of a particular keyword by using a word-processing program. Just use the ‘Word Count’ and the ‘Replace’ functions.
